Output 2fbf57805807bc529cd0d836e7e667c3289a8564f66fdc9ab1b9aec4e0db4110:0

value
18574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5acc233115aba6b3bc6eba4e31457939df03cbed OP_EQUAL
address
39y7HXbp4AVE3Zb3vPfvxAbXBBU4ocNAJL
transaction
2fbf57805807bc529cd0d836e7e667c3289a8564f66fdc9ab1b9aec4e0db4110
confirmations
16123
spent
true